Portable HIV Monitoring Device Shows Promise for Remote Settings

Summary by Newswise
A newly developed microfluidic biosensor promises to reshape how CD4+ T cells — key indicators of immune function in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) patients — are detected. By integrating electrochemical impedance spectroscopy into a compact lab-on-a-chip system, the device delivers precise, label-free measurements without the need for bulky lab equipment.
